Love version 4; 5 not so much
I am not a power user but I do use Tap Forms daily for personal, work related, and record keeping I do for a non-profit. For me iCloud syncing worked flawlessly. I upgraded to 5 at it's release and attempted to sync using both Cloudant and the local syncing option. I had no success with either. The Cloudant fees also concerned me although I did not use the service to approach $50 month fee allowance provided. I immediately returned to version 4. Not sure why iCloud syncing was abandoned but that has proven to be a deal breaker for me. Took one star away because of usability issues with version 5.

Yet another cloud subscription - ARRRGGG!
First let me say that I LOVE Tap Forms. It reminds me of the old Symantec Q&A. Simple, yet powerful. Maybe as nice as the old venerable Lotus Approach.
I've been using Tap Forms for several years now, and it fits the bill for all of my filing needs. No, it isn't a Filemaker Pro replacement. It doesn't try to be. But for the most complicated and complex databases, this workes wonderfully. Really.
Being notified of the version 5 upgrade, I paid the very reasonable fee for the upgrade. However, I was surprised to learn that syncing no longer worked, and to enable it, I must purchase yet another subscription service. Enough already!!! Everyone and their uncles are subscribing me into the poor house!
So . . . I've deleted the version 5 of Tap Forms and returned to the 4.x version, which syncs using the iCloud that I already have.
If there was an option for version 5 of Tap Forms to use iCloud, then I would have given it a 5-Star rating.
If you don't mind yet another subscription service, then you can't go wrong getting Tap Forms 5.

Response from developer
Cloudant sync is for all intents and purposes free. They provide a generous amount of free activity that nobody I know has ever exceeded in a month period. Also in Tap Forms 5.1 I've added iCloud sync as a new sync option. Version 5.1 is currently in beta testing and I hope to release it within the next few weeks. Stay tuned!
